Sindh CM launches Guzara Allowance ATM card for distribution of Zakat

byCustoms Today Report
27/06/2015
in Business
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

KARACHI: Sindh Chief Minister Syed Qaim Ali Shah Saturday said that distribution of Zakat is a great religious responsibility, therefore we have to be careful and responsible while its distribution among the deserving people.

This he said while addressing the inauguration ceremony of Rs 1 billion Guzara Allowance ATM cards scheme for needy people here.

The ceremony was attended by Minister for Zakat and Usher Dost Mohammad Rahimoo, Chairman Sindh Zakat Council Justice (retd) Zahid Qurban Alvi, President Sindh Bank Bilal Shaikh and other senior officers.

The chief minister said that government was releasing over Rs 1.34 billion in the head of zakat every year. “The old zakat distribution system was fraught with loopholes. That’s why taking a practical step we decided to distribute zakat among the registered needy through ATM cards.

Giving beak up of the Zakat funds, he said that government has released Rs 1 billion for Guzara Allowance for 83,000 registered needy people. Apart from it, Rs 214.8 million for education stipend, Rs 20 million for stipend to Deeni madaras, Rs 47.3 million to hospitals for health care, Rs 27.8 million for rehabilitation, Rs 5 million for education foundation and Rs 33.1 million for marriage assistance.

Addressing on the occasion, the Minister for Zakat and Usher said that earlier the Guzara Allowance distribution was entrusted to NADRA but they had a few centers which caused problems for the needy people.

“Now, it has been given to Sindh Bank which has issued ATM cards. This is a transparent system,’ he said.

President Sindh Bank Bilal Shaikh said “we do not charge commission or services charges on distribution of Zakat through ATM cards”.

The chief minister also distributed Guzara Allowance ATM cards among deserving and needy women who were present on the occasion.
